Presenters/Authors

Displaying 1 - 6 of 6
Texas Tech University Health Sciences Center
TX, United States
Cape Breton University
Canada
Texas Tech University Health Sciences Center
TX, United States
Cape Breton University
NS, Canada
Texas Tech University Health Sciences Center
TX, United States
University of Aveiro
Aveiro, Portugal
(clear all)

Organization